Maya Angelou () - 20th century African-American writer, poet and activist. Best-known for her work "I Know Why A Caged Bird Sings". 
 
Jane Austen () - English novelist known primarily for her six major novels, which interpret, critique and comment upon the British landed gentry at the end of the 18th century. Known for Sense and Sensibility, Pride and Prejudice, Mansfield Park, Emma

A 9-month-old child is seen in the well clinic. Which of the following behaviors would the nurse expect to see? SATA 
(A) Plays peek-a-boo 
(B) Walks independently 
(C) Feeds self with a spoon 
(D) Stacks 2 blocks together 
(E) Transfers objects from hand to hand - A, E 
-walks independently at 15 months 
-feeds self with spoon at 18 months 
-stacks 2 blocks together at 18 months
